Transaction ef30c60708c6f4812151818c6e9a9046951ac18c43d2dd0459c4bf60fa3e1377

1 Input
2 Outputs
  • ef30c60708c6f4812151818c6e9a9046951ac18c43d2dd0459c4bf60fa3e1377:0
  • value  646800
    address  2MzRhiBYdVd2ZocYcU5oeogNZVt42FPpR9Z
  • ef30c60708c6f4812151818c6e9a9046951ac18c43d2dd0459c4bf60fa3e1377:1
  • value  353027
    address  2NCxkuhAHWsCrw8tLdcnyqVh3d7wZhy94nT